Desenvolvedor Troca Especificações por Propostas para Sessões de Código Paralelas do Claude

O Problema com a Abordagem de Especificações Primeiro
O desenvolvedor encontrou problemas em que escrever especificações detalhadas antecipadamente levava a código gerado por IA que era tecnicamente correto, mas contextualmente errado. A especificação diria "adicionar limitação de taxa aos endpoints de autenticação", mas não incluiria contexto sobre abordagens previamente rejeitadas (como baldes de token) ou decisões de implementação (como escolher Redis em vez do Cloudflare para staging). Isso criava situações em que a IA fazia escolhas razoáveis que reabriam decisões já fechadas.
Atualizar especificações tornou-se seu próprio mini-projeto, e quando as especificações atualizadas eram revisadas, a base de código já havia divergido. A especificação capturava o "o quê", mas perdia o "porquê"—todo o raciocínio, alternativas rejeitadas e o momento das decisões estavam faltando.
A Alternativa de Propostas Primeiro
Em vez de escrever especificações antecipadamente e codificar para corresponder a elas, o desenvolvedor escreve propostas—documentos curtos que capturam por que uma mudança está acontecendo, o que foi considerado e rejeitado, e o que está dentro ou fora do escopo. A especificação é atualizada após o código ser implementado para refletir o que realmente foi construído.
Exemplo de comparação:
- Uma especificação diz: "O sistema deve suportar limitação de taxa."
- Uma proposta diz: "Ataques de força bruta detectados em produção. Adicionando limitação de taxa via janela deslizante + Redis (Cloudflare não disponível em staging). Rejeitado balde de token devido a problemas de tráfego em rajada. Escopo: apenas login + redefinição de senha."
A proposta dá à IA (e aos futuros desenvolvedores) o quadro completo.
Fluxo de Trabalho de Propostas Paralelas
O desenvolvedor executa várias sessões do Claude Code simultaneamente, cada uma trabalhando em uma proposta diferente. Às vezes, ele cria propostas concorrentes resolvendo o mesmo problema de ângulos diferentes.
Fluxo de trabalho típico:
- Trabalhando em 2-3 funcionalidades/bugs/problemas ao mesmo tempo
- Criando 1 ou 2 propostas para abordagens diferentes por problema
- Iniciando sessões do Claude Code para cada proposta para executar em paralelo
- Cada sessão produz um PR no GitHub
- PRs do GitHub servem como plataforma de revisão de propostas
- Revisando abordagem e código juntos
- Se duas propostas abordam o mesmo problema de forma diferente, escolhendo a melhor e fechando a outra
- Uma vez que os PRs aprovados são implementados, instruindo o Claude a implementar as propostas
- Atualizando a especificação para refletir as mudanças de código para referência rápida em propostas futuras
A especificação se torna um documento vivo que sempre corresponde à realidade, em vez de um documento aspiracional que diverge desde o primeiro dia.
Ciclo PACE
O desenvolvedor chama esse ciclo de PACE (para lembrar os passos):
- Propor: Escrever uma proposta curta com contexto e raciocínio
- Aprovar: Revisar no PR do GitHub, abordagem (aprovar, revisar, rejeitar)
- Codificar: A IA implementa exatamente o que foi proposto, nada mais
- Evoluir: Atualizar a especificação para refletir a nova realidade
📖 Read the full source: r/ClaudeAI
👀 See Also

Fluxos de trabalho práticos do OpenClaw: automação do TikTok, monitoramento de portfólio, engajamento no Reddit e tarefas agendadas.
Um não-desenvolvedor com formação marítima compartilha quatro fluxos de trabalho específicos do OpenClaw: automação de carrossel do TikTok custando US$ 0,02 por post, rastreamento de portfólio com DuckDB, automação de comentários no Reddit e automação de tarefas agendadas com cron.

Desenvolvedor Solo Gerencia Empresa com 4 Agentes de IA no Plano Gratuito do Gemini
Um desenvolvedor em Taiwan construiu quatro agentes de IA usando OpenClaw e o nível gratuito do Gemini 2.5 Flash (1.500 solicitações/dia) para lidar com geração de conteúdo, prospecção de vendas, varredura de segurança e operações para sua agência de tecnologia, com custos mensais de LLM em US$ 0.

Programa de Parceiros Claude: Consultoria de Duas Pessoas Atende Requisito de Dez com Profissionais Independentes Certificados
Uma consultoria de IA com apenas duas pessoas usou o Claude para entrar no Programa de Parceiros da Anthropic e, em seguida, o utilizou para recrutar uma equipe de profissionais independentes certificados para atender ao requisito de 10 pessoas.
Claude Code vs Codex: Análise Prática de 6 Projetos
Um experimento prático comparando Claude Code e Codex em 6 projetos — web, backend e desafio livre — com revisões cruzadas, autoauditorias e pontuação.